MATLAB är en matematik - baserat programmeringsspråk . Det ger snabb åtkomst till vanliga high - funktion beräkningsverktyg och en omfattande tredimensionell plottning kapacitet . I matematik , är en matris ett tvådimensionellt rutnät av siffror . I MATLAB kan matriser multipliceras mot varandra med hjälp av variabler och enkla matematiska uttryck . Språket kan bearbeta matriserna baserat på deras dimensioner och utför matrismultiplikationen . MATLAB kommer först testa om det är möjligt att multiplicera matriserna och beräknar därefter. Instruktioner
1
Skapa en ny matris och ange det lika med variabeln A genom att skriva " A = metoden ", där metoden är matrisen skapande metoden . MATLAB innehåller många olika metoder för matris skapas . Den " pascal ( x ) " metoden skapar en x -by - x symmetrisk matris med Pascal sekvensen . Den " magiska ( x ) " metoden skapar en x - by- x icke - symmetrisk matris med slumptal . Den " fix ( 10 * rand ( x, y) ) "-metoden kommer att skapa en x -by- y matris av slumpmässiga heltal . " [ x , y , ... ] " kommer att skapa en enda kolumn matris med värdena i uppsättningen mellan konsolerna . " [ xy ... n ] " kommer att skapa en enradig matris med värdegrund mellan konsolerna .
2
Skapa en andra matris och tilldela den till en variabel B. Matrisen kan också vara en skalär värde , eller 1 -by - 1 matris , genom att sätta det lika med bara ett nummer , . dvs " B = 3 " Addera 3
Bestäm multiplikation ordning . Eftersom multiplikation av matriser är inte kommutativ , A * B inte att vara lika B * A.
4
Kontrollera att antalet kolumner i den första matrisen är lika med antalet rader i den andra kolumnen . Ett fel uppstår om matriserna inte följer denna regel . Ignorera denna regel om en av matriserna är skalär . Produkten av multiplikationen kommer att ha samma antal rader som den första matrisen och samma antal kolumner som den andra matrisen.
5
Type " X = A * B" att multiplicera matriser och ställa värdet lika med variabeln X. Omvänd matrisen variabler som behövs .